Overview

Alcudia de Monteagud is a quiet, picturesque village set in the Sierra de los Filabres of Almeria, Spain. With only 128 residents, it offers a serene escape and authentic Andalusian rural life, surrounded by beautiful mountain scenery.

Best Time to Visit

April-June and September-October for pleasant weather and village festivals.

Local Tips

Carry cash as card payments may not be widely accepted; public transport is extremely limited, so car rental is recommended.

Cultural Etiquette

Greet locals with a friendly 'hola'; casual, modest dress is appreciated. Tipping in restaurants is optional, with rounding up the bill being common.

Safety Warnings

Village is very safe; watch for narrow, steep roads when driving, especially at night. No common scams reported.

Hidden Gems

Explore the old chapel of La Ermita, walk the scenic trails to nearby viewpoints, and visit the traditional olive oil mill if open.
